Your mission, roles and responsibilities

The role of the Safety and Regulation Coordinator is to ensure the implementation of quality methods at the plant in order to deliver products that meet requirements based on qualified processes. These methods are based on FES, standard processes, and principles of prevention and continuous improvement.  

                                                                 
Ensure, through S/R audits, that the appropriate tools to meet requirements are in place
Coordinate improvement plans in line with the objectives committed to for their scope
Audit production lines against standards                                                
Compile and analyze S/R audit results to identify top offenders and systemic failures requiring correction
Ensure the plant’s compliance with FES, safety and regulatory requirements, and automotive standards
Train and raise awareness among staff on S/R issues
Ensure compliance with corrective actions implemented for previous S/R incidents
Development and execution of an audit plan for preventive monitoring.
Review of the PSR Matrix for new projects
Provide support and advise quality engineers on safety and regulatory matters
Guide teams in investigations when a safety and regulatory incident occurs                              
Use the AMS system to trigger alerts in the event of safety and regulatory incidents
Monitor AMS alerts to ensure timely resolution

Design and implementation of a task force for the most affected areas
Participate in the AMEF review

FORVIA is an automotive technology group at the heart of smarter and more sustainable mobility. We bring together expertise in electronics, clean mobility, lighting, interiors, seating, and lifecycle solutions to drive change in the automotive industry.

With a history stretching back more than a century, we are the 7th largest global automotive supplier, employing more than 157,000 people in 43 countries. You'll find our technology in around 1 out of 2 vehicles produced anywhere in the world.

In June 2022, we became the 1st global automotive group to be certified with the SBTI Net-Zero Standard. We have committed to reach CO2 Net Zero by no later than 2045.
